I use several, in heavy cover using 3/4 to 1oz jigs or big football jigs, a Falcon Cara Amistad. Lighter jigs (1/2 oz or so) I use a Lowrider MH 7'. For finesse jigs I use a Lowrider 6'8" AOY.

currently I only throw 1/2oz football and flipping jigs, and I throw em on a 7' MH Veritas and really like it. I like it better than the Skeet Reese micro guide jig rod. the Veritas has enough tip to do accurate roll casts and enough backbone to get fish out of cover and into the boat
